Commercial Pothole Repair in Little Rock, AR
Commercial pothole repair services focus on restoring damaged pavement surfaces caused by frequent traffic, weather conditions, or aging infrastructure. These repairs are suitable for parking lots, driveways, loading zones, and other paved areas on commercial properties. The process involves identifying potholes, cleaning out debris, and filling the openings with durable materials to ensure a smooth, safe surface. Property owners often seek this service to prevent further deterioration, reduce liability risks, and maintain a professional appearance for their business or property.
Before requesting pothole repair,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the damage, the materials used for repairs, and the expected longevity of the fix. It’s important to assess whether multiple potholes or widespread pavement issues are present, as this may influence the scope of work. Additionally, property owners usually inquire about how repairs will blend with existing pavement and what maintenance might be needed afterward to keep surfaces in good condition. Clear communication about these aspects helps ensure the repairs meet the needs of the property.
